2
0
mirror of https://github.com/boostorg/yap.git synced 2026-02-22 16:02:10 +00:00
Commit Graph

14 Commits

Author SHA1 Message Date
Zach Laine
1fe42d079c TODO cruft removal. 2016-12-13 17:06:32 -06:00
Zach Laine
5d539bbb81 Swap order of template params to terminal<> and expression_ref<> aliases to match the convention of the rest of the library. 2016-12-07 20:01:27 -06:00
Zach Laine
1964805e89 Break up headers into more chunks. 2016-12-07 20:01:27 -06:00
Zach Laine
ce5a0a8744 Move lib headers to boost/yap. 2016-12-07 20:01:24 -06:00
Zach Laine
dda826b95c proto17 -> yap 2016-12-07 20:01:24 -06:00
Zach Laine
53e882212d Remove unhelpful TODOs. 2016-12-07 20:01:23 -06:00
Zach Laine
29a7bedc00 Add reference-to-expr expr_kind expr_ref; expressions used in other expressions are now captured by reference. 2016-12-07 20:01:20 -06:00
Zach Laine
0033b42734 Replace parameter pack in expression<> with a single Tuple param. 2016-12-07 20:01:19 -06:00
Zach Laine
15e70fefe1 Pass individual args through evaluate*(), instead of making a tuple of them. 2016-12-07 20:01:17 -06:00
Zach Laine
1fbc68f611 Add test of templated transform_expression. 2016-12-07 20:01:17 -06:00
Zach Laine
d1c3734945 Remove use of eval_expression_as on subexpressions; add transform_expression. 2016-12-07 20:01:17 -06:00
Zach Laine
db5f016146 Update user_expression_transform test to highlight an error in transform matching. 2016-12-07 20:01:17 -06:00
Zach Laine
274b39ba86 Move more test code to standalone tests. 2016-12-07 20:01:16 -06:00
Zach Laine
9206d77b72 Move user_expression_transform to a standalone test. 2016-12-07 20:01:16 -06:00